## Artifact Signing — Tollgrave Payments CI

Integration tests in the Tollgrave payments service flake on signature steps when the test fixture artifacts go stale. Regenerate fixtures with `tg fixtures rebuild`, then re-sign. Do not skip signing to unblock CI; downstream replay depends on valid signatures. Retries mask the problem — fix fixtures instead. Verification in CI pins the key listed below.

signing key of bagap-yawep = bky13_TbfT6ZMUoGJo2

Subject: Partner SFTP drop — new owner

Hi,

As you review the pending changes to the Harborline ingest scripts, note that ownership of the partner SFTP drop is changing at the end of the month. This includes key rotation, the nightly pull job, and the quarantine folder for malformed files. Review comments on the retry logic should still go through the normal PR flow, but questions about drop-folder conventions or partner onboarding now go to the new owner. The incoming owner is listed below.

signatory, tagaf-bahaf: Praael Fenmir Rusok

### Step 7: Decide on websocket compression

Quick heads up: enabling permessage-deflate on the Bramblewire gateway cut bandwidth ~60% but cost us noticeable CPU and added latency spikes under load. We settled on compressing only messages over 1KB and skipping already-compact binary frames. Future maintainers: resist turning it on globally; measure first. If you do revisit this, start from the current gateway settings, which are shown below.

settings of tagef-bawif:
DRUIX_HOST=druix.zemvarlabs.internal
DRUIX_PORT=8000

Audit item 7: Turnstile counter reconciliation. Confirm that the GateTally service at Ravenport Arena reconciles per-turnstile counts against the master attendance ledger every fifteen minutes, and that discrepancies above 0.5% trigger an alert rather than silent correction. Verify retention of raw pulse logs for ninety days and that the calibration procedure was run after last month's hardware swap. Evidence review is owned by:

account owner for bawip-tahag: Raleth Quenok